SB2017092108 - Multiple vulnerabilities in Cisco Unified Intelligence Center

Description
This security bulletin contains information about 3 secuirty vulnerabilities.
1) Cross-site scripting (CVE-ID: CVE-2017-12248)
The disclosed v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form cross-site scripting (XSS) attacks.
The vulnerability exists in the web framework code of Cisco Unified Intelligence Center Software due to insufficient sanitization of user-supplied data. A remote attacker can trick the victim to follow a specially crafted link and execute arbitrary HTML and script code in user's browser in context of vulnerable website.
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ow a remote attacker to steal potentially sensitive information, change appearance of the web page, perform phishing and drive-by-download attacks.
2) Cross-site scripting (CVE-ID: CVE-2017-12254)
The disclosed v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form Document Object Model (DOM)-based cross-site scripting attack.
The vulnerability exists in the web interface code of Cisco Unified Intelligence Center Software due to insufficient sanitization of user-supplied data. A remote attacker can trick the victim to follow a specially crafted link and execute arbitrary HTML and script code in user's browser in context of vulnerable website.
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ow a remote attacker to steal potentially sensitive information, change appearance of the web page, perform phishing and drive-by-download attacks.
3) Cross-site request forgery (CVE-ID: CVE-2017-12253)
The vulnerability allows a remote unauthenticated attacker to perform CSRF attack.The weakness exists due to a lack of cross-site request forgery (CSRF) protection. A remote attacker can create a specially crafted HTML page or URL, trick the victim into visiting it, gain access to the system and perform arbitrary actions.
